## Set the Encryption Key
|
||||

Currently, there are three methods to obtain the key:
|
||||
|
||||
1. Via adopting a BLE shade: There is a [shade emulator](/emu/PV_BLE_cover) that works with Arduino IDE and an ESP32 device (≥ 2MiB flash, ≥ 128KiB required), e.g. [Adafruit QT Py ESP32-S3](https://www.adafruit.com/product/5426). Install and connect via serial port, then go to the PowerView app and add the shade `myPVcover` to your home. You will see a log message `set shade key: \xx\xx\xx\xx\xx\xx\xx\xx\xx\xx\xx\xx\xx\xx\xx\xx` . Copy this key. You can delete the shade from the app when done.
|
||||
2. Extracting from gateway: This [script](scripts/extract_gateway3_homekey.py) is able to extract the key from a working PowerView gateway.
